Nov
10
2008
Quem anda pelo mundo da programação à algum tempo já deve ter ouvido falar do NetBeans, um IDE (Integrated Development Environment) Open-Source que suporta uma série de linguagens de programação.

Segundo a página do projecto, o NetBeans é a única ferramenta que necessitam caso pretendam desenvolver aplicações profissionais tanto para o Desktop, como para a Web e mesmo para telemóvel, seja na linguagem Java, C/C++ ou Ruby. Além disso o NetBeans está disponivel para Windows, Linux, Mac OS X e Solaris o que faz com que seja uma ferramenta perfeita para quem trabalha com multiplos ambientes.
No próximo dia 20 a SUN pretende lançar a versão final do NetBeans 6.5, que trará suporte as linguagens PHP, JavaScript e Ajax, Ruby on Rails, Groovy e suporte melhorado para bases de dados, para além das descritas anteriormente.

Outra melhoria nesta nova versão foi a actualização do Projecto Matisse, incorporado a partir da versão 5.5 e agora denominado Swing GUI Builder que fornece uma excelente ferramenta de construção de interfaces gráficos para Java.
O NetBeans passou também a suportar diagramas UML, que para quem não sabe, são diagramas que tendem a representar um sistema através de um conjunto de diagramas, onde cada diagrama se refere a uma visão parcial do sistema, que em conjunto forma um todo integrado e coerente.

Por isso se pretendem uma ferramenta livre, multi plataforma e polivalente para desenvolverem aplicações o NetBeans é sem duvida uma ferramenta a ter em conta.
{via peopleware}
NetBeans IDE 6.5 - Features | Realease Notes | Download
Relacionados
Nov
02
2008
JDownloader é um programa de gestão de downloads que permite automizar o mais possível a descarga de ficheiros alojados em servidores do tipo one-click-hosters.

Este tipo de servidores têm normalmente os ficheiros divididos em várias partes, o que torna por vezes a tarefa de ir buscar ficheiros muito aborrecida. O JDownloader após a inserção de todos as hiperligações das partes do ficheiro, realiza o descarregamento das mesmas “poupando o trabalho” de ter de escrever em cada parte os códigos de verificação e ordena ainda as partes a descarregar.
Continuar a ler »
Relacionados
Oct
17
2008
O Java, da Sun, em tempos foi proprietário. Entretanto, quase todo o código foi tornado livre quando a Sun lançou o OpenJDK. Como ficaram algumas coisas por “libertar”, apareceram vários projectos que tentaram lançar a sua implementação totalmente livre do Java. Um deles é o IcedTea, lançado pela Red Hat e baseado no OpenJDK.
Há uns dias, uma nova versão do OpenJDK foi disponibilizada pela Sun. A comunidade do IcedTea não perdeu tempo e, no dia 15 deste mês - à dois dias atrás -, lançou o IcedTea6 1.3, baseado na nova versão do OpenJDK. Uma das novidades desta nova versão é o suporte para PulseAudio, um servidor de áudio livre multi-plataforma; as restantes podem ser lidas no comunicado oficial.
Os utilizadores do Fedora e Red Hat podem descarregar o pacote RPM oficial do projecto. Os utilizadores de outras distribuições do GNU/Linux e outros sistemas terão que compilar o IcedTea ou esperar que um pacote apareça para o seu sistema.
{Download}
Relacionados
Jun
25
2008
O Código do Java foi totalmente aberto.
Cerca de 5% do código do java ainda não estava aberto, simplesmente porque a SUN não detinha os direitos sobre esse código. Agora o projecto IcedTea criado pela Red Hat conseguiu repor todo o código fechado por equivalente aberto e esse código passou nos testes de compatibilidade.
Para já apenas o Fedora 9 tem essa versão de Java, mas num futuro próximo outras distribuições passarão a distribuir java por defeito, mesmo as que só contêm software livre.
Relacionados
Mar
30
2008
Areca Backup é uma aplicação livre para a realização de backups em Java, o que permite que seja executada em qualquer sistema com Java instalado.
O programa suporta compressão e encriptação dos dados, backups incrementais, envio dos backups por FTP, execução de shell scripts após o término do backup, delta backups e pesquisa de ficheiros.
A nova versão do Areca Backup, versão 6.0, trás suporte para mais línguas e delta backups (cópia de segurança apenas das partes alteradas de um ficheiro e não do ficheiro todo) e várias correcções de erros.
Download | Página oficial
Relacionados
Mar
13
2008
E que tal compreender o mundo da programação orientada a objectos, num ambiente totalmente diferente, como se de um jogo se tratasse… se alinham nisso, então conheçam o Alice, pois ele serve para isso mesmo.
Desenvolvido na Universidade de Carnegie Mellon, o Alice é um programa grátis e aberto desenvolvido em Java e multi plataforma, feito com o objectivo de colmatar as falhas denotadas no inicio da aprendizagem da programação.
Além de se ter revelado um óptimo instrumento pedagógico aumentando bastante os rendimentos na aprendizagem, neste momento encontra-se em desenvolvimento a sua 3º versão que contará com as personagens do jogo Sims e que portanto, terá mão da EA.
Download
Relacionados
Mar
04
2008
GmailAssistant é uma aplicação livre multi-plataforma, escrita em Java. Este programa notifica os utilizadores da chegada de novos emails na sua conta ou contas de email no Gmail.com.
Para utilizarem esta aplicação, necessitam da versão 6 do Java Runtime Environment (JRE), disponível para download em Sun.com.
Algumas das funcionalidades do GmailAssistant, actualmente na versão 1.0, são o suporte para duas ou mais contas de email em simultâneo, utilização de uma cor diferente para cada conta e diferentes tipos de notificação da chegada de novos emails.
Para aceder ao Gmail, esta aplicação utiliza o protocolo IMAP e faz uma ligação segura através de SSL.
Download
Relacionados
Feb
08
2008

CodeLite IDE for C/C++ é uma aplicação livre para programadores que criam código nas linguagens de programação C e C++, distribuido sob os termos da licença GNU General Public License (GPL).
Infelizmente, o site oficial do CodeLite não faz menção às novidades da nova versão. Contúdo, menciona algumas das imensas funcionalidades da aplicação, como highlight para as linguagens C, C++, Java, Perl, XML e Lua, e para os Makefile e Diff; suporte para compiladores; possibilidade de expandir as funcionalidades através de plugins; exploraor de ficheiros; e bookmarks.
Esta aplicação está disponível para Windows, mas também para GNU/Linux.
Relacionados
Aug
07
2007
Quando entrei no mundo Linux o que mais me surpreendeu foi a existência de vários programas para fazer algo que estava habituado à fazer apenas com uma aplicação em Windows. No inicio não percebi bem mas aos poucos entendi que mais vale ter uma ferramenta que faz pouco e bem de que muito e mal. Pois bem, a aplicação multiplataforma que vos apresento a seguir vai em sentido contrário ao que é habitual em Linux. É um “tudo em 1″.

Continuar a ler »
Relacionados
Jul
31
2007
Eu sei que dizer isso pode parecer sacrilégio mas eu não gosto de programas feitos em java, ou pelo menos da maioria. São pesados, por vezes complexos de instalar, e visualmente devo dizer que nem sempre me agradam. Eu sei, eu sei, é uma linguagem que corre facilmente em qualquer sistema operativo. Quanto à isso não há dúvidas. Vamos ver se com este programa que vou agora apresentar começo a mudar de opinião…
Existem algumas pérolas feitas nesta linguagem e uma delas é certamente o numericalchameleon. Eu sou da área de engenharia e é frequente trabalhar com cálculos e com várias unidades por isso um programa para converter dá sempre jeito. Mas como veremos mais à frente esta aplicação é bem mais de que isso e não se destina apenas a técnicos e estudante…

Continuar a ler »
Relacionados